Boy Smells ‘Hinoki Fantôme’

Score: 86%

Notes: (Floral Family) resin, hinoki, cardamom, jasmine, moss

In our words: Boy Smells is a brand this close to being a top-tier candle maker, but their candles are inconsistent making it difficult to know if you’re getting a great candle, or a lemon. Hinoki Fantôme falls into the camp of being one of Boy Smells good candles. The resin and jasmine come together to give this a woody-floral blend that is sweet and earthy. In a studio apartment, this candle filled the space nicely, but in a larger space it was hit or miss if you would be able to pick up its scent or not. All in all, it is a really wonderful candle, and a B+ rating should validate you trying it out — but our expectations for this candle were quite high and this fell short of our lofty fantasy.
